Output 94e59af7f975bf8b1434b588e9d2253f5231d114c375bcf0a26c16abbe91d22a:115

value
707200
script pubkey
OP_0 OP_PUSHBYTES_20 8f52c6fbe8db83d0acae836a4c18857907de1980
address
bc1q3afvd7lgmwpapt9wsd4ycxy90yrauxvqgw9fdm
transaction
94e59af7f975bf8b1434b588e9d2253f5231d114c375bcf0a26c16abbe91d22a
spent
true